Output 4d586d9605a4ab76e39bd1dc756ed8b9c7ed6b10e9761dad7cec9a56180f42d5:1

value
677600
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7f68f134e3a009a94750d33619117646f12a2471 OP_EQUAL
address
3DJhTRFrK4PbySYgSpAGwEpXburBKENTjE
transaction
4d586d9605a4ab76e39bd1dc756ed8b9c7ed6b10e9761dad7cec9a56180f42d5
spent
true